    Substanz's frog is really close to what we're looking for. A realistic, cute, yet cartoonish frog that looks happy/friendly, but still professional.

    Here are a few ideas we've had for possible cool logos:

    1. The word "FROGit" or "FrogIt" in cool text, each word being a different color. Then a frog to the right of the text with an visual trail behind it showing where it had bounced on the text.

    2. The word "FROGit" or "FrogIt" in cool text, each word being a different color. Then a frog either grabbing the dot of the 'i' with it's tongue or a fly that's in place of the dot of the 'i'.

    3. The word "FROGit" or "FrogIt" in cool text, each word being a different color. Make the 'o' of frog a magnifying glass with a blown up frog eye in it.

    Again, you aren't required to follow these suggestions, but we just thought these ideas might look good.
